BYD's Fifth-Generation DM Hybrid Technology Boosts Fuel Efficiency

BYD, a leading automotive company with ticker symbols HKG: 1211 and OTCMKTS: BYDDY, has made a significant leap in fuel efficiency with its fifth-generation DM hybrid technology. The National Motor Vehicle Quality Inspection and Testing Center (Guangdong) has certified this improvement.

The new DM 5.0 technology, officially launched on May 28, 2024, has reduced fuel consumption to just 2.6 liters per 100 km under NEDC test conditions when the battery is depleted. This represents a 10% improvement from the previous 2.9 liters per 100 km benchmark introduced in May 2024.

Key features enabling this improvement include a high engine thermal efficiency of 46.06%, a smart, intelligent control system, a powerful electric motor and advanced battery pack, extensive data-driven software and hardware coordination, integration with e-platform 3.0 and CTB battery body integration technology, and a redesigned petrol engine that functions as a generator to recharge the battery during driving.

This holistic approach combines a high-efficiency combustion engine, intelligent hybrid mode switching, advanced battery and motor technology, and continuous optimization with big data and software upgrades. The result is industry-leading fuel economy and driving range.

The first models equipped with the fifth-generation DM technology were the BYD Qin L DM-i and Seal 06 DM-i, launched on May 28, 2023. Both vehicles boast a combined range of up to 2,100 kilometers, about three times that of traditional fuel vehicles.

In July 2024, BYD sold 344,296 New Energy Vehicles (NEVs), a 0.56% increase year-on-year but a 10.01% decrease from June. The sales data shows a mixed picture for BYD, with strong BEV sales but declining PHEV sales. Specifically, the sales of BYD's PHEV models decreased by 22.61% year-on-year and 4.45% from June, with 163,143 units sold in July.

Despite a 14.02% decline from June, BYD's passenger BEV sales remained strong, with 177,887 units sold in July, a 36.84% increase year-on-year. This marks the fourth consecutive month of year-on-year decline in BYD's passenger PHEV sales, with the decline widening from 12.45% in June.

The sales data, released on August 1, 2024, does not include sales of traditional fuel vehicles. The fuel efficiency optimization will be provided to all BYD vehicles equipped with the fifth-generation DM technology through over-the-air (OTA) upgrades.
